The global Minimally Invasive Direct Coronary Artery Bypass (MIDCAB) market size was valued at approximately USD 750 million in 2025 and is projected to reach USD 1.45 billion by 2035, growing at a CAGR of 6.8% during the forecast period. Minimally Invasive Direct Coronary Artery Bypass is a surgical approach for coronary artery bypass grafting that emphasizes reduced trauma and faster recovery compared to traditional methods. The market encompasses the specialized equipment required for this procedure, including microsurgical instruments and robotic systems, designed to execute precise operations with minimal incisions. This sub-sector of the healthcare industry serves hospitals, specialty clinics, and cardiac centers, attracting key stakeholders such as equipment manufacturers, healthcare providers, surgeons, and healthcare technology innovators.
